- Elementary (TV series) - Wikipedia
Elementary is an American procedural comedy-drama television series that presented a contemporary update of Arthur Conan Doyle 's character Sherlock Holmes Created by Robert Doherty and starring Jonny Lee Miller as Sherlock Holmes and Lucy Liu as Dr Joan Watson, the series aired on CBS for seven seasons from September 27, 2012, and ended on August 15, 2019, after 154 episodes The series was

- elementary - WordReference. com Dictionary of English
el•e•men•ta•ry (el′ə men′ tə rē, -trē), adj pertaining to or dealing with elements, rudiments, or first principles: an elementary grammar of or pertaining to an elementary school: elementary teachers of the nature of an ultimate constituent; simple or uncompounded pertaining to the four elements, earth, water, air, and fire, or to the great forces of nature; elemental
